Output 615e66bfb14d9297b570770749053ff99a25f208babdce219756572a125fb890:25

value
20000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 08a9966b2f720e5210abbe6ae3775ebb91bb9c1d73fff27cb77b83bbca6e7c9e
address
bc1ppz5ev6e0wg89yy9the4wxa67hwgmh8qaw0llyl9h0wpmhjnw0j0qzup8k4
transaction
615e66bfb14d9297b570770749053ff99a25f208babdce219756572a125fb890
spent
true